Application Process:
Applications will be accepted via ERAS beginning September 3rd, 2025, with a deadline of November 1st, 2025. The Nampa Residency Program is a separate ERAS application process and match from all other Full Circle Family Medicine Residency of Idaho programs. We are doing all our interviews via a virtual process. We recognize that this has positives—lower cost and time spent on travel— but also has the negatives of not experiencing the community in which you will live and learn. We believe an all-virtual process will decrease the potential for bias that may arise from seeing some applicants virtually and others in person. We do know that many of you may want to see our community and we will have a separate team that is not involved in the interview or ranking process that can provide you with a tour if you happen to be in town. Please reach out to Esmeralda Espinoza, program coordinator, who will be the contact of this team to schedule a tour. After we conclude our ranking process, we will hold an open house/social in-person in January, as well as a virtual social / PD Q&A session.
We acknowledge that the changes to ERAS have added some additional complexity this year, so we want to be clear about how our program is planning to proceed. We will honor program signals in the application screening process, but we will not be utilizing geographical location preference at this time. Program signals will be considered only for the decision to interview and will not be part of our ranking process. Additionally, we believe in holistic review and intend to purposefully review applications which may lead to delayed interview offers. Thank you for your patience in this process.
Application Requirements:
- Need 3 Letters of Recommendation, 1 must be Family Medicine
 - Graduated last 3 years (preference)*
 - Passed Step 1 or COMLEX 1 **
 - International Medical Graduates
- We do sponsor J1 and H1-B visas but must have a strong Idaho connection.
 - Must have recent and relevant US clinical experience.
 
 
*Will review all applicants but those that match our requirements will have priority.
**Step 2 / COMLEX 2 pass is required to be ranked.

Top 10 Full Circle Health Nampa Program Highlights:
- Full-spectrum rural-focused residency training program. Extensive opportunities to work in rural sites across Idaho!
 - Outstanding hospital support – State-of-the-Art community hospital within St. Luke’s Health System
 - Teaching Health Center = Residency + Federally Qualified Health Center
- 25% of Nampa’s Hispanic heritage – Opportunity to use/learn Medical Spanish with 18% of Nampa population who are Spanish-speaking.
 - Sliding scale for patients in need
 - Access to specialty clinics including OMT, GYN, Sports Medicine, Comprehensive Care, OB, and Rheumatology
 - Team-based care that includes:
- Clinical Pharmacy
 - Community Health Workers
 - Dietician
 - Behavioral Health Clinicians and Psychology Interns
 
 
 - Procedural Training
- POCUS
 - EGD & Colonoscopies
 - Circumcisions
 - Vasectomies
 - Gyn Procedures including LARCs
 - Skin Procedures
 - Joint Injections
 - Facial Distortion Model… and more.
 
 - Embedded Longitudinal Behavioral Health with Psychology Faculty
 - Location – Location – Location – Easy access to outdoor recreation year-round
 - Program Director with over 25 years medical education experience
 - Wellness & Community Curriculum embedded throughout training. A Unique opportunity to engage with the community through association with 6 different community partners.
 - University of Washington School of Medicine Affiliated Residency Program with access to the UW library and additional resources.
 - Competitive Salary and Benefits Package
- CME Time & Money (R1 $1,000; R2 $1,250; R3 $1,500)
 - Meal stipend for all inpatient rotations
